Windsor HondaWindsor, ON New, Windsor Honda sells and services Honda vehicles in the greater Windsor area.7180 Tecumseh Rd E, Windsor, ON N8T 1E6Canada Nearest Zenbu Listings
Sponsored Links
Nearest Automotive Business listings
About Zenbu
Zenbu is a collaboratively edited directory of businesses, places or things. You can help build Zenbu, edit this entry, report an error.
Login required: Edit, Export, Add branch / neighbour / new |
|